    Another day brings more news about the Galaxy S26. The well-known leaker UniverseIce has suggested that the upcoming Galaxy S26 series will feature Qualcomm’s newest flagship SoC for smartphones, the Snapdragon 8 Elite 2.

    Details About the Processor

    According to the leaker’s post on X, the Galaxy S26 lineup will utilize the Snapdragon 8 Elite 2 for Galaxy, which is based on TSMC technology. The mention of “with TSMC” technology is quite intriguing, as there have been rumors that Qualcomm might also be utilizing Samsung’s SF2 node for a different version of the Snapdragon 8 Elite 2. This alternate version is expected to be less expensive than the TSMC version, possibly using the TSMC N3P 3 nm process node.

    Different Smartphone Segments

    Qualcomm’s strategy of using both Samsung SF2 and TSMC N3P nodes could lead to two distinct classes of Android smartphones powered by the Snapdragon 8 Elite 2. One segment may offer more budget-friendly “flagship killers,” especially from Chinese manufacturers like Oppo and Xiaomi, which will use the less expensive Snapdragon 8 Elite 2. The other segment could feature true high-end flagship devices like the Galaxy S26 Ultra, equipped with the premium Snapdragon 8 Elite 2 manufactured on the TSMC node.

    Performance Enhancements

    Furthermore, UniverseIce states that the Snapdragon 8 Elite 2 for Galaxy in the S26 series will operate at speeds of up to 4.74 GHz. This represents a 6% boost in clock speed compared to the previous Snapdragon 8 Elite for Galaxy, which is expected to significantly enhance the single-core performance of the chipset.

    In conclusion, while UniverseIce indicates that the Snapdragon 8 Elite 2 will be present in all Galaxy S26 models, it wouldn’t be surprising if Samsung opts to use the Exynos 2600 in certain regions. Reportedly, the Exynos 2600 is manufactured using Samsung’s SF2 2 nm process node and has shown good performance in its pre-release testing.

    Murmurs about a Samsung Foundry-made Snapdragon 8 Elite 2 had been going around the online space. Then soon after, another rumor claimed that it was completely scrapped. Now, leaker Digital Chat Station from Weibo has mentioned that the SM8850s (likely a codename for the aforementioned chip) is still in the game.

    Speculations About Launch Dates

    According to DCS, some OEMs might choose to avoid the very costly TSMC N3P-made Snapdragon 8 Elite 2 and instead go for the Samsung version. However, it seems it won’t be released at the same time as its TSMC N3P counterpart toward the end of September since Samsung is still working diligently to stabilize yields for its 2 nm SF2 node, which is the foundation for the SM8850s.

    New Developments in the Snapdragon Lineup

    This is an interesting turn of events, as the Snapdragon 8 Elite 2 was mostly thought to be the ‘For Galaxy’ edition aimed at Samsung’s foldable devices like the Galaxy Z Fold 8 and Galaxy Z Flip 8. This will result in two classification of Snapdragon 8 Elite 2 devices: one utilizing Samsung chips and another using TSMC.

    Sadly, users won’t have any easy way to differentiate them without conducting benchmarks. On paper, the performance should be the same, but historically, Samsung Foundry’s chips have underperformed compared to TSMC’s, and there’s no compelling reason to think this trend will change shortly.

    Broader Device Compatibility

    On the bright side, this news isn’t all bad because it opens the door for the Snapdragon 8 Elite 2 to be included in a wider array of devices. OEMs wanting to introduce budget-friendly flagship phones can rely on the less expensive version and pass the cost savings down to the consumers.
